Full list of words from this list:

  1. swath
    a path or strip (also figurative)
  2. Seder
    the ceremonial dinner on the first night of Passover
  3. Passover
    (Judaism) a Jewish festival (traditionally 8 days from Nissan 15) celebrating the exodus of the Israelites from Egypt
  4. wreath
    a circular band of flowers or other foliage
  5. thwart
    hinder or prevent, as an effort, plan, or desire
  6. portent
    a sign of something about to happen
  7. presage
    a foreboding about what is about to happen
  8. levee
    an embankment built to prevent a river from overflowing
  9. breach
    an opening, especially a gap in a dike or fortification
  10. burrow
    a hole made by an animal, usually for shelter
  11. muskrat
    beaver-like aquatic rodent of North America with dark glossy brown fur
  12. tick off
    put a check mark on or near or next to
  13. withholding
    the act of holding back or keeping within your possession or control
  14. tough
    substantially made or constructed
  15. haste
    overly eager speed and possible carelessness
  16. christen
    administer baptism to
  17. sparkler
    firework that burns slowly and throws out a shower of sparks
